Maze Therapeutics, Inc. (MAZE) had a notice of proposed sale of common stock filed under Rule 144 for the account of officer Jason V. Coloma. The notice covers 34,501 shares of MAZE common stock held at UBS Financial Services Inc., with an indicated market value of $908,066.32 and 55,549,168 shares of common stock outstanding as of September 1, 2026. Recent sales over the prior three months were made by the Coloma Family Trust and The Coloma 2021 Irrevocable Trust, with multiple transactions in June, July, and August 2026.

Rule 144 regulatory
"See the definition of "person" in paragraph (a) of Rule 144."
Rule 144 is a U.S. securities regulation that sets conditions under which restricted or insider-held shares can be legally resold to the public, such as required holding periods, availability of public information, limits on how much can be sold at once, and certain filing requirements. For investors it matters because it determines when previously locked-up shares can enter the market — like a release valve that can increase supply, affect share price, and signal insider intent.
irrevocable trust financial
"The Coloma 2021 Irrevocable Trust DTD 09/20/2021"
An irrevocable trust is a legal arrangement where an owner transfers assets into a separate entity managed by a trustee and gives up the power to modify or reclaim those assets. For investors it matters because putting stock or other holdings into such a trust can change who controls and benefits from the assets, affect taxes and creditor protection, and influence how easy it is to sell or value those holdings—like placing valuables in a locked safe overseen by someone else.
attorney-in-fact regulatory
"UBS Financial Services Inc., as attorney-in-fact for Jason Coloma"
An attorney-in-fact is the person or entity given legal authority through a power of attorney to act on behalf of another for specific tasks, such as signing documents, voting shares, or handling transactions. For investors, this matters because it lets a trusted representative make timely decisions or complete paperwork when the owner cannot, much like handing keys to someone to run errands on your behalf—so checks on scope and limits of that authority are important.
